Bug ID: 519985
Summary: kpreviewjob not cleaning up downloaded files from MTP
devices after thumbnail generation

When browsing folders on an MTP device (phone via USB) with previews enabled,
Dolphin downloads full files to ~/.cache/dolphin/kpreviewjob/ for thumbnail
generation but never deletes them afterward.
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Connect Android phone via USB (MTP)
2. Browse phone folders containing media files with previews enabled in Dolphin
3. Check ~/.cache/dolphin/kpreviewjob/ after browsing
4. Observe full copies of media files cached
Expected Behavior:
Files downloaded for thumbnail generation should be automatically deleted after
thumbnails are created.
Actual Behavior:
Files remain in cache indefinitely. Cache grows to several GB. Files are
playable/viewable directly from cache.
Impact:
Privacy issue - sensitive files (e.g., ID documents) transferred from phone
remain cached in unencrypted form even after being moved to encrypted storage.
